those white rubber bumpers that fit on the bottom of chairs from home depot. you can cut them shorter if you want.

most of my cues dont even have a bumper on the bottom.
or one of those table slider things at h.d. that stick on. take your cue with you and find something that works there.

good luck. hope you get back on your feet soon.
 
Crutch/chair tips are too small.You would need 1.25 inch or bigger.Maybe a pvc pipe end cap. Or like someone said Amazon has a sleeve that will slide over the butt that also has a rubber bottom. the ones I saw were 4 for under 10 bucks
